In many Eastern cultures, particularly in South Azerbaijan and across the Turkic world, the oral tradition was the primary vehicle for education. Before books were widely accessible, life lessons were distilled into short, rhythmic, and memorable phrases. Elders would use these proverbs to settle disputes,

A common sentiment in this tradition is the warning against idle talk. As noted in historical texts like those discussing Dede Korkut , when a man cannot achieve a task with his hands, he often gives strength to his tongue—a cautionary reminder to favor action over empty words. 4.
